Potential Risks of Blocking GDF15 ‐Based Brain Energy Sensing

Abstract

GDF15 signals energetic stress to the brain, leading to unpleasant symptoms as the body conserves and reallocates energy. In conditions such as frailty and cancer, suppression of GDF15 signaling is expected to lead to an improvement in symptoms, but potentially at the cost of long-term health and survival.
